The argument: AI tools are structurally flawed in ways that money incentives prevent us from scrutinizing. The author coins "Gell-Mann's Apathy" -- experts who spot AI errors in other people's fields but trust it blindly in their own. Vibe-coding gets particular scorn as brute-forcing solutions through compute while hiding real costs in software quality and externalized risk. A polemic, but a pointed one.
